Southwest Warren, Warren, MI Local Guide

Cheapest Available Southwest Warren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Southwest Warren area of Detroit, MI is a Studio unit found at Belmont Manor priced from $720. Chateau Manor has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$945. Here are the most affordable Southwest Warren apartments for rent in Detroit, MI:

Apartment ListingModel NameBed/BathPriced From
Belmont ManorStudioStudio,1BA$720
Chateau ManorOne Bedroom1BR,1BA$945
Warren Woods1 Bedroom - 1 Bath1BR,1BA$978
Warren ManorOne Bedroom - Classic Unit1BR,1BA$1,040
Maple Grove1 bed1BR,1BA$1,049
1771 E Woodward Heights Blvd1 Bedroom1BR,1BA$1,065
RSAN on Woodward HeightsOne Bedroom1BR,1BA$1,075
Parkview Village ApartmentsBerkley1BR,1BA$1,090
E Outer Drive Apartments1BR/1.0BA1BR,1BA$1,095
